Unlock the Mystery of Error 402: Fix It Now & Boost Your Site's Performance!
In the world of website management and development, encountering errors is an inevitable part of the process. One such error that can cause significant disruption is the Error 402. This guide delves deep into what Error 402 is, why it occurs, and most importantly, how to fix it to enhance your site's performance. We will also explore how tools like APIPark can assist in managing and optimizing your site's API resources.
Understanding Error 402
Error 402, also known as the Payment Required error, is an HTTP status code that indicates the server is unable to complete the request because the client has not paid for the resource. Although this error is less common than other HTTP errors like 404 (Not Found) or 500 (Internal Server Error), it can still be problematic for users trying to access your site.
Why Does Error 402 Occur?
Error 402 typically occurs in one of two scenarios:
- Subscription or Payment Issues: The most straightforward reason for this error is if the user or the site itself requires a subscription or payment to access certain resources, and this has not been fulfilled.
- Misconfiguration: Sometimes, a misconfiguration in the server settings can trigger a 402 error. This might happen if the server is incorrectly set up to require payment for resources that should be freely accessible.
The Impact of Error 402 on Site Performance
While Error 402 might not directly impact the site's technical performance, it can have significant implications for user experience and, consequently, site performance:
- User Frustration: Users encountering a 402 error may feel frustrated and confused, leading to a poor user experience.
- Reduced Traffic: If users frequently encounter this error, they may stop visiting your site, resulting in lower traffic.
- Revenue Loss: For e-commerce sites, a 402 error can lead to lost sales opportunities if users are unable to access purchaseable content.
Fixing Error 402
To fix Error 402, you need to identify the root cause and address it accordingly. Here are some steps you can take:
Check Subscription/Payment Status
If your site requires users to pay or subscribe to access certain resources, ensure that the user's payment or subscription status is up-to-date. If the payment has not been processed, you may need to investigate the payment gateway for issues or provide alternative payment options.
Review Server Configuration
Check your server settings to ensure that they are correctly configured. Look for any anomalies in the configuration that might be causing the server to incorrectly require payment for certain resources.
Clear Browser Cache
Sometimes, the issue may lie within the user's browser. Encourage users to clear their browser cache and cookies, as this can resolve transient issues that might cause a 402 error.
Use a Diagnostic Tool
Consider using diagnostic tools to identify the specific cause of the error. Tools like APIPark can help you monitor your API resources and identify any issues that might be causing the 402 error.
APIPark is a high-performance AI gateway that allows you to securely access the most comprehensive LLM APIs globally on the APIPark platform, including OpenAI, Anthropic, Mistral, Llama2, Google Gemini, and more.Try APIPark now! πππ
Boosting Site Performance
Once you've resolved the Error 402, it's essential to focus on enhancing your site's overall performance. Here are some strategies:
Optimize Images and Media Files
Large images and media files can significantly slow down your site. Use tools to compress these files without compromising quality. This can lead to faster load times and a better user experience.
Minimize HTTP Requests
Reduce the number of HTTP requests your site makes by combining files, using CSS sprites, and minimizing the use of external resources. This can help reduce load times and improve site performance.
Use a Content Delivery Network (CDN)
A CDN can help distribute your content across multiple servers worldwide, ensuring that users can access your site quickly from any location. This can reduce latency and improve load times.
Implement Caching
Caching can help store copies of your site's pages on users' browsers, reducing the need for the server to regenerate the pages each time they visit. This can significantly improve load times.
Monitor and Analyze Site Performance
Use tools like Google Analytics or APIPark to monitor your site's performance. Analyze key metrics such as load times, bounce rates, and user behavior to identify areas for improvement.
Table: Common HTTP Errors and Their Impact on Site Performance
| HTTP Error | Description | Impact on Site Performance |
|---|---|---|
| 404 Not Found | The requested resource could not be found. | Can lead to user frustration and increased bounce rates. |
| 500 Internal Server Error | A generic server error occurred. | Can result in site downtime and a poor user experience. |
| 402 Payment Required | The server requires payment to access the resource. | Can cause user frustration and lost revenue if not addressed promptly. |
| 408 Request Timeout | The server timed out waiting for the request. | Can lead to a poor user experience and potential loss of data entered by the user. |
| 503 Service Unavailable | The server is temporarily unable to handle the request. | Can result in site downtime and a negative impact on SEO. |
How APIPark Can Help
APIPark is an open-source AI gateway and API management platform that can assist in managing your site's API resources effectively. Here's how it can help:
- API Monitoring: APIPark provides comprehensive monitoring capabilities, allowing you to track the performance and health of your APIs in real-time.
- Error Detection: It can help detect and alert you to any issues with your APIs, including 402 errors, enabling you to address them promptly.
- Resource Management: APIPark allows you to manage and optimize your API resources efficiently, ensuring that your site's performance is not compromised.
Frequently Asked Questions (FAQs)
Q1: What is Error 402, and how does it affect my site's performance?
A1: Error 402 is an HTTP status code indicating that the server cannot complete the request because the client has not paid for the resource. While it doesn't directly impact your site's technical performance, it can lead to user frustration, reduced traffic, and lost revenue.
Q2: How can I fix Error 402 on my site?
A2: To fix Error 402, you should check the user's subscription or payment status, review your server configuration for any anomalies, clear the browser cache, and use diagnostic tools like APIPark to identify the specific cause of the error.
Q3: Can using a CDN improve my site's performance?
A3: Yes, using a CDN can help distribute your content across multiple servers worldwide, reducing latency and improving load times for users accessing your site from different locations.
Q4: How does APIPark help in managing API resources?
A4: APIPark provides a unified platform for managing, integrating, and deploying API resources. It offers features like real-time monitoring, error detection, and resource optimization, ensuring that your site's API resources are efficiently managed.
Q5: Is APIPark suitable for both small and large enterprises?
A5: Yes, APIPark is suitable for both small startups and large enterprises. It offers a range of features that can cater to different needs, and its open-source nature makes it accessible to a wide range of users.
By understanding and addressing Error 402 effectively, and by leveraging tools like APIPark, you can enhance your site's performance and provide a better user experience for your visitors.
πYou can securely and efficiently call the OpenAI API on APIPark in just two steps:
Step 1: Deploy the APIPark AI gateway in 5 minutes.
APIPark is developed based on Golang, offering strong product performance and low development and maintenance costs. You can deploy APIPark with a single command line.
curl -sSO https://download.apipark.com/install/quick-start.sh; bash quick-start.sh

In my experience, you can see the successful deployment interface within 5 to 10 minutes. Then, you can log in to APIPark using your account.

Step 2: Call the OpenAI API.
